context "When duplicate headers exist" do
it "outputs a message to stdout" do
output = capture_stdout { Cleaner.new(input_filepath:, output_filepath:, log_filepath:).clean }
expect(output).to match "\n>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Duplicate header found. This will misalign column headings. Please delete or rename the duplicate column: StartDate \n>>>>>>>>>>>>>> \n"
end
end
context "Creating a new Cleaner" do
it "creates a directory for the clean data" do
Cleaner.new(input_filepath:, output_filepath:, log_filepath:).clean
expect(output_filepath).to exist
end
it "creates a directory for the removed data" do
Cleaner.new(input_filepath:, output_filepath:, log_filepath:).clean
expect(log_filepath).to exist
end
end
context ".process_raw_file" do
it "sorts data into valid and invalid csvs" do
cleaner = Cleaner.new(input_filepath:, output_filepath:, log_filepath:)
processed_data = cleaner.process_raw_file(
file: path_to_sample_raw_file
)
processed_data in [headers, clean_csv, log_csv, data]
reads_headers_from_raw_csv(processed_data)
valid_rows = %w[1000 1001 1003 1004 1005 1008 1017 1018 1019 1020 1024 1026
1027 1028]
valid_rows.each do |response_id|
valid_row = data.find { |row| row.response_id == response_id }
expect(valid_row.valid?).to eq true
end
invalid_rows = %w[1002 1006 1007 1009 1010 1011 1012 1013 1014 1015 1016 1021 1022 1023 1025 1029 1030 1031 1032
1033 1034]
invalid_rows.each do |response_id|
invalid_row = data.find { |row| row.response_id == response_id }
expect(invalid_row.valid?).to eq false
end
expect(clean_csv.length).to eq valid_rows.length + 1 # headers + rows
expect(log_csv.length).to eq invalid_rows.length + 1 # headers + rows
csv_contains_the_correct_rows(clean_csv, valid_rows)
csv_contains_the_correct_rows(log_csv, invalid_rows)
invalid_rows_are_rejected_for_the_correct_reasons(data)
end
end
